Brian Caswell, a 74 year old EuroMillions winner, smashed up a car while road testing it in Bury. Brian Caswell who scooped £25 million playing the EuroMillions Lottery back in June took a luxury £55,000 Range Rover out for a test drive but returned it with over £6,000 worth of damage.

The elderly lottery winner had been lent the super-charged Range Rover Sport to get a feel for it while he waited for his brand new one to be delivered. A source at Stratstone Land Rover in Bury, where Mr Caswell borrowed the vehicle from said “He was really apologetic, but wouldn’t say how it happened.They continued by saying “Brian said he wanted it so he could drive his wife round in style, but looking at the damage I bet it was a bit of a bumpy ride.

The damage caused by the mysterious accident left the £55,000 Range Rover needing a new side panel and wing mirror plus a re-spray but any bill faced by Britain’s third largest lottery winner will be nothing more than pocket change to him. When asked about the accident Brian’s wife Joan simply replied “You’ll have to speak to Brian about that”.

The retired sales director from Bolton, who became Britain’s third largest lottery winner when he won £24,951,269 playing the EuroMillions lottery claimed that he would not have selected his winning numbers had it not been for his late mother-in-law saying “I always used to take my mother-in-law shopping on Fridays and she always used to buy tickets for herself and her grandchildren. Unfortunately we lost her last year but I kept on buying those tickets ever since because of her. It’s her legacy.
